Kindo: [Minor spoilers; involves a conversation with Dandelion about a recently recovered memory.] Greetings,
So I was playing along, doing quests on the Kaedweni side of the spectral fog during Act 2. Once I had paid a visit to an old friend, in a hideout in the ravines, Geralt remembered pursuing the Wild Hunt. Once back in the Kaedweni camp, I paid Dandelion a visit - as per usual - to discuss this newly recovered memory. I've done this many times before, but this is the first time I notice that Geralt accidentally reads the wrong line at one point during the conversation. Instead of reading what the correct line where he mentions that all the villages he passed through only had old people left in them, and how no-one wants to tell him what's happened to their children - as the subtitles stand witness to - he reads a line related to a completely different conversation with Dandelion that you might have if you were on Iorveth's path of the story, in Vergen, regarding whether or not Saskia is to be trusted (if I recall correctly).
Link to video - the line I speak of occurs close to 20 seconds into the clip.
The weird thing is that I have never noticed this before, and this is hardly the first time I play the Kaedwen side of the story, and I know that I've had this exact conversation with Dandelion several times - yet, I never noticed this bug. Anyway, it's more amusing than anything, and thought I'd share. :)
